Comparative study of Cu/ZnO/Al 2 O 3 (CZA) catalysts with different Cu loading in CO and CO 2 hydrogenation at 250 C under atmospheric pressure was investigated. Results showed that methanol was the major product for CO hydrogenation, while the main product for CO 2 hydrogenation was CO. High Cu loading catalyst exhibited high catalytic activity in both CO and CO 2 hydrogenation. Low Cu loading catalyst showed deactivation with time on stream after 1-2 h by coke formation containing both amorphous and graphitic cokes for both CO and CO 2 hydrogenation.
